How much does it cost to rent a home in Boyette Creek?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Boyette Creek 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,848 | $1,450 | $2,099 |
Boyette Creek 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,407 | $1,676 | $3,800 |
Boyette Creek 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,822 | $2,195 | $4,500 |
Boyette Creek 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,771 | $2,700 | $5,999 |
Boyette Creek 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,600 | $3,600 | $3,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Boyette Creek
What type of rentals are currently available in Boyette Creek?
There are currently 33 Apartments for Rent in Boyette Creek,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,183 to $4,606. There are also 91 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Boyette Creek ranging from $1,350 to $5,999.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Boyette Creek?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Boyette Creek ranges from $1,350 to $5,999 with an average monthly rent of $2,633.
